Airlines to hike fares in India
New Delhi, Feb 10: Reports suggest that all major airlines in India, including the low-cost carriers have withdrawn all promotional fares and increased basic fares between Rs 1800-2000 on several sectors from Tuesday, Feb 10.
Industry sources said that the airlines operators took the decision as the 'promotional fares' did not yield the necessary results. "We have discontinued our promotional fares as the response has not been very good, but people who have already bought tickets under the scheme will enjoy the benefit, Air India spokesperson informed media.
Meanwhile, spokesperson of Kingfisher Airlines said that the airlines have closed low fare buckets and are concentrating on setting higher fare buckets. "Our focus is on revenue and not seat factors," he said.
